Git 操作指南
Git是一款免费、开源的分布式版本控制系统,用于敏捷高效地处理任何或小或大的项目
1. 生成gitlab的SSH keys
(1) 使用命令:ssh-keygen
然后系统提示输入文件保存位置等信息,连续敲三次回车即可,生成的SSH key文件保存在中~/.ssh/id_rsa.pub
(2) 使用命令:vim ~/.ssh/id_rsa.pub 或 more ~/.ssh/id_rsa.pub
使用命令查看key内容
(3) gitlab 添加SSH-key
2. 克隆远程仓库项目
使用命令 : git clone git@gitlab.xxxxxxxxx.cn:customer/project.git
3. 创建本地分支dev
使用命令:git checkout -b dev
4. 使用命令: git add *
添加需要提交的文件
5. 使用命令:git commit -m '提交描述'
用于提交文件
6. 使用命令:git checkout master
切换分支到master主干上,等会合并dev分支和远程origin/master分支内容
7. 使用命令:git pull
合并origin/master分支内容
8. 使用命令:git merge dev
合并 dev分支内容
9. 遇到冲突修改后,再次使用4和5步骤提交冲突文件
10. 使用命令:git push -u origin master
提交本地仓库内容至远程仓库
备注:
设置提交用户邮箱,必须与gitlab邮箱一致,否则提交不成功
git config --global user.name "Your Name"
git config --global user.email you@example.com
git config --global user.email you@example.com
参考资料:
http://www.cnblogs.com/BeginMan/p/3543240.html